About ethyl 4-chloro-5-[2-(difluoromethoxy)-4-(1,1,1,3,3,3-hexafluoro-2-hydroxypropan-2-yl)phenyl]-1-ethylpyrazole-3-carboxylate

ethyl 4-chloro-5-[2-(difluoromethoxy)-4-(1,1,1,3,3,3-hexafluoro-2-hydroxypropan-2-yl)phenyl]-1-ethylpyrazole-3-carboxylate (PubChem CID 146287565) has the molecular formula C18H15ClF8N2O4 and a molecular weight of 510.77 g/mol. Its IUPAC name is ethyl 4-chloro-5-[2-(difluoromethoxy)-4-(1,1,1,3,3,3-hexafluoro-2-hydroxypropan-2-yl)phenyl]-1-ethylpyrazole-3-carboxylate.
